n African Union signs ag technology access deal<br />

The African Union Commission <strong>and</strong> the African Agricultural<br />

to African farmers. The continent has one of the lowest levels<br />

of farm productivity in the world as a result of the absence<br />

of agricultural technologies to deal with pests <strong>and</strong> diseases<br />

that face the region’s smallholder farmers, the partners say.<br />

The Foundation works in eight sub-Sahara African countries.<br />

Priority areas for the Foundation include addressing the<br />

impact of climate change in agriculture; pest management;<br />

soil management, nutrient enhancement in foods; improved<br />

breeding methods; <strong>and</strong> mechanisation. These are addressed<br />

through the access, development <strong>and</strong> deployment of accessible,<br />

transferable, adaptable <strong>and</strong> proven technologies.<br />

Output 2009 2010 2011<br />

Six “main” manufacturers 173,900 209,200 207,300<br />

National 384,100 379,400 291,700<br />

Top six share 45.3% 55.2% 71.1%<br />

1 CCPIA figures only include the country's “major producers”, <strong>and</strong> do not<br />

accurately reflect the total national output. Source: CCPIA.<br />

The CCPIA expects global requirements for glyphosate over the<br />

next five years to remain in the region of between 550,000<br />

tonnes <strong>and</strong> 650,000 tonnes. As the number of manufacturers<br />

declines, it hopes that the “blind competition” in the market<br />

that has driven prices down will also be reduced.<br />
